Maybe you’ve always wanted to improve the audio quality of your smartphone’s audio recordings by using a condenser microphone instead of the phone’s built-in mic. But is this even possible? Can you use a condenser microphone with a phone?

You can connect and use a condenser microphone can with a phone. This can be achieved by connecting the condenser microphone to the phone’s charging port or headphone jack. Depending on the type of phone and condenser mic you have, you might need a connection adapter or phantom power supply box.

Devices That Can Help You Connect Condenser Mics to Phones

Audio Interface

The best way to connect a condenser microphone to a phone is by using an audio interface. Audio interfaces are devices that allow you to send a microphone or musical instrument’s audio signal to a computer or phone.

Audio interfaces have XLR and ¼” that allow you to plug in a microphone or any instrument directly into them. And then, they also have analog-to-digital converters that will convert the audio signal into a digital format that your phone can read.

Most audio interfaces also have a phantom power supply. So they can supply condenser mics with the needed phantom power for them to work.

Something worth mentioning is any audio interface with a microphone input, and phantom power will work. However, most audio interfaces available today have USB 2 and USB 3 connections. They are meant to be used with computers, not phones.

So if you want to connect an audio interface to your phone, you’ll need an OTG adapter. 

If you use an Android, iPhone, or iPad with a USB-C port, then you’ll need a USB-C to USB 3 OTG Adapter. For Android phones with a Micro USB charging port, you’ll need a Micro-USB to USB 3 OTG Adapter. And for users of iPhones or iPads with a Lightning port, you’ll need a Lightning to USB 3 Adapter. Connection Adapters

As you may already know, most condenser microphones are connected using XLR cables. There are few condenser mics available today that use USB connections and TRRS jacks, but most are XLR ports. 

Unfortunately, phones don’t have an XLR port. And this means you can’t connect most condenser mics directly to your phone. And this is where connection adapters come in.

Connection adapters allow you to connect microphones to your smartphones using the phone’s headphone jack or charging ports.

There are many different connection adapters available today. And depending on the phone and the condenser mic you’re using, one may be a better option than the other. Let’s take a look at the different options available.

XLR to 3.5mm Connector Adapter 

XLR to 3.5mm Connector Adapter (on Amazon) is similar to the one described above. It lets you connect XLR condenser microphones to phones via their 3.5mm headphone jack. 

The only difference is that this option does not have a phantom power supply. So if you want to go for this option, you should either have a battery-powered condenser mic or use it with a phantom power supply box.

Lightning to 3.5mm Connector Adapter – iOS

Lightning to 3.5mm Adapters (also on Amazon) is a little similar to the XLR to 3.5mm adapter. However, this adapter is meant for only iPhones and iPads.

As you may already know, Apple removed the headphone jack from the iPhone in 2016 with the release of the iPhone 7. And it has remained the same for all iPhones released after 2016. 

Thus, this lightning to 3.5mm adapter enables you to connect devices that come with 3.5mm audio pins to lightning devices. Therefore, you can use it to connect condenser microphones that have 3.5mm audio plugs to iOS devices like iPhones and iPads.

Audio Monitoring and Recording App

Unlike the connectors I have mentioned above, audio monitoring and recording apps do not directly help you connect a condenser microphone to a smartphone. 

However, they play an important role when connecting condenser microphones to smartphones. Without these audio monitoring and recording apps, you may not be able to use your condenser microphone when you connect it to your phone. 

This is because most of the apps that come with your smartphone are not compatible with condenser microphones.

It will surprise you to know that your phone’s default camera, which is used to record videos, does not work with condenser microphones. 

Due to this, you will need these third-party audio monitoring and recording apps to help you use your condenser microphone when you connect it to a smartphone. 

They support recording using external microphones. Some of these audio monitoring and recording apps include; Open CameraDolby On, and Cinema FV-5.

How To Connect A Condenser Mic To Phone

There are two primary ways to connect a condenser mic to your phone. One way is to connect the mic to your phone via the headphone jack. And the other way is to connect the condenser mic to your phone via the charging port.

And from the numerous devices we’ve discussed, there are multiple ways to do this. So let’s take a look at them.

Connection Via The Headphone Jack

If you own a condenser microphone such as this one on Amazon, which has a 3.5mm input jack, you can connect it directly to your phone. These types of condenser mic are designed to work with devices without the need for phantom power.

On the other hand, if you own a traditional XLR condenser microphone that requires phantom power, and you want to connect and use it with your phone via the headphone jack, you’ll need a connection adapter.

In this instance, you’ll need an XLR to 3.5mm Connection Adapter. Either the type with phantom power or the type without will work, just as we’ve already discussed earlier. However, if you want to go for the XLR to 3.5mm connector without a phantom power supply, you’ll need a phantom power supply box.

Connection Via The Charging Port

There are multiple ways to connect a condenser microphone to a smartphone via the charging port. And we’ve already discussed the devices that make it possible to do that.

If you use an iPhone or iPad and you want to use an audio interface with your condenser mic, you’ll need a Lightning to USB Connector. This will allow you to plug an audio interface into your phone. And we’ve already discussed this in the audio interface section of this article.

Similarly, if you want to connect your condenser mic to an Android phone using an audio interface, you’ll need an OTG Adapter. Depending on the phone you’re using, this could be either a Micro USB to USB 3 Connection Adapter or a USB-C to USB 3 Connection Adapter.

Suppose you’re an iPhone or iPad, and you want to connect your condenser mic directly to your device. In that case, you’ll need either an XLR to Lightning Connector or a Lightning to 3.5mm Connector, depending on whether your condenser mic has an XLR jack or a 3.5mm jack. 

This also means you’ll need a phantom power supply box for your XLR condenser mic.
